Q: Is 38,454,819 a Prime Number?
A: No, 38,454,819 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 38454819 can be evenly divided by 1 3 13 39 821 1,201 2,463 3,603 10,673 15,613 32,019 46,839 986,021 2,958,063 12,818,273 and 38,454,819, with no remainder.
Since 38,454,819 cannot be divided by just 1 and 38,454,819, it is not a prime number.
